The Evolution Of Mobile Wireless Communications: Connecting The World

mobile wireless communications have revolutionized the way people communicate and access information. With the advancement of technology, we have seen significant improvements in the speed, reliability, and coverage of mobile networks. From the early days of analog cellular networks to the current era of 5G, mobile wireless communications have come a long way in connecting people around the world.

The first generation of mobile wireless communications, also known as 1G, was introduced in the 1980s. This technology allowed basic voice calls on analog networks, with limited coverage and poor call quality. The transition to digital networks with 2G brought improvements in call quality and security, paving the way for the introduction of text messaging and basic data services.

The advent of 3G technology marked a significant milestone in mobile communications, enabling high-speed data services such as mobile internet browsing and video calling. This technology laid the foundation for the rise of smartphones and mobile applications, transforming the way people interact and consume content on their devices.

The arrival of 4G LTE brought even faster data speeds and lower latency, making it possible to stream high-definition videos, play online games, and use bandwidth-intensive applications on mobile devices. This technology also enabled the development of the Internet of Things (IoT), connecting a wide range of devices and sensors to the internet for real-time data exchange and automation.

The latest generation of mobile wireless communications, 5G, promises to deliver even faster speeds, lower latency, and higher capacity for data-intensive applications. With the rollout of 5G networks around the world, we can expect to see further innovations in areas such as augmented reality, virtual reality, connected vehicles, and smart cities.

One of the key benefits of 5G technology is its ability to support a massive number of connected devices simultaneously, making it ideal for applications that require real-time communication and high bandwidth. This will enable the development of new services and industries that rely on instant connectivity and data exchange, such as autonomous vehicles, remote healthcare, and smart grid systems.

In addition to improved speed and capacity, 5G networks are also expected to offer lower latency, which is crucial for applications that require instant response times, such as gaming, virtual reality, and industrial automation. With 5G technology, we can expect to see a new era of innovation and connectivity that will transform industries and improve people’s lives.

The rollout of 5G networks is already underway in many countries, with mobile operators and technology companies investing heavily in upgrading their infrastructure to support the new technology. In the coming years, we can expect to see a proliferation of 5G-enabled devices, new applications and services, and a more connected world that leverages the power of high-speed mobile communications.

Despite the many benefits of 5G technology, there are also challenges and concerns that need to be addressed. One of the main challenges is the deployment of 5G networks in rural and remote areas, where infrastructure and coverage are limited. Ensuring equitable access to 5G technology for all populations will be crucial to bridging the digital divide and achieving universal connectivity.

Another concern is the potential impact of 5G technology on health and the environment, with some studies raising questions about the long-term effects of electromagnetic radiation from mobile networks. It will be important for regulators, industry stakeholders, and the public to work together to address these issues and ensure the safe and sustainable deployment of 5G technology.
